Jordan | The Public Security Directorate warns of the formation of frost and the risk of slipping

<p style=";text-align:left;direction:ltr">Weather of Arabia - The Public Security Directorate warned citizens today of very cold weather, which will lead, with the late night hours, to the formation of frost over the highlands and desert areas, the formation of fog, and the appearance of clouds at low altitudes<br /><br /> The Directorate called for caution, especially since it is expected that the rain and snow will recede, which may prompt some people to leave by vehicle or on foot, especially to or in areas that have witnessed snowfall.<br /><br /> The Directorate stressed the need to be careful while driving, for fear of the risk of slipping, or low visibility due to fog<br /><br /> She pointed to the necessity of safe use of fireplaces, not leaving them burning when sleeping, not leaving them unattended, checking them, and ventilating homes from time to time.</p>
